Who is the Sabre-450 for?
The Sabre-450 is recommended for the following professional profiles:
-
Professional carpenters and furniture manufacturers: straight, curved, and re-sawing cuts on solid wood, plywood, and panels.
-
Advanced hobbyists and artisan workshops: precision machining of single pieces and small series, model making, and inlay work.
Not suitable for: processing metals or hard industrial materials (machine dedicated to wood: for metals, use metal bandsaws with reduced speed).

Does it have multiple cutting speeds?
Professional models offer 2 speeds (e.g., 370/800 m/min) to adapt to materials: low for hardwoods, high for softwoods.
Lower speeds reduce the risk of burning on hard essences (oak, beech). High speeds optimize performance on pine and particle boards.
Is the table inclinable?
Yes, professional models have an inclinable table up to 45° for angled cuts.
The inclination allows for miter cuts for joints and furniture details. Check for a stop at 0° inclination for repeatability on straight cuts.
